A Federal Government Department is seeking experienced Senior Power Platform Administrators & Developers to join a high-performing team responsible for the administration, development and ongoing optimisation of a Microsoft Power Platform environment. The successful candidates will play a key role in ensuring the platform remains secure, scalable and aligned with enterprise architecture, cyber security, information management and service management requirements. The successful Senior Power Platform Administrators & Developers will be offered an initial contract through to 30 June 2027 with a 12-month extension option.

The successful Senior Power Platform Administrators & Developers will be responsible for, but not limited to:

  • Administering and maintaining Power Platform environments, including provisioning, access management, governance controls, monitoring and lifecycle management.
  • Designing, developing and supporting enterprise solutions using Power Apps, Power Automate, Dataverse, Power Pages and Power Fx.
  • Managing platform security, DLP policies, Entra ID integration, RBAC, service principals and privileged access controls.
  • Designing data models, workflows and integrations using APIs, custom connectors, Azure services and Dataverse capabilities.
  • Supporting ALM, Azure DevOps and CI/CD processes while collaborating with architects, cyber security teams and business stakeholders to deliver secure enterprise solutions.

The successful Senior SOE Engineer / Lead Supporting Architect will have experience in the following:

  • Demonstrated experience administering and developing Microsoft Power Platform solutions within large-scale Government or enterprise environments.
  • Strong hands-on expertise across Power Apps, Power Automate, Dataverse, Power Pages, Power Fx and Power Platform administration.
  • Experience implementing governance, security and compliance controls, including DLP, Managed Environments, Entra ID and RBAC.
  • Strong experience with Azure DevOps, Power Platform CLI, source control, ALM and automated CI/CD deployment processes.
  • Experience developing enterprise-grade applications, integrations and custom extensions using JavaScript, TypeScript, C#, REST APIs, custom connectors and Dataverse plug-ins.
